  • Illinois Death May Be First Related To Vaping In US, Officials Say

    The Illinois Department of Public Health is investigating what it thinks may be the first death related to vaping in the country. We talk about what officials think may be happening, as Wisconsin continues to investigate hospitalizations that may also be related to vaping.
